Chandler admitted to a ‘sexual encounter’ with the young teen, but said they did not have intercourse, according to a police report obtained by WBTW.
She also claimed to have believed the boy was older than he was, though ‘mistake of age’ is not a defense in South Carolina law.
The report said that the 14-year-old told police that he met his accused abuser when she was delivering food.
The pair are understood to have exchanged phone numbers on November 16 and began texting each other.
During the investigation, Chandler gave a written statement that said the boy had taken the gun out of her car after she had gone to a friend’s house to discuss that she had been talking to the minor.
If Chandler is found guilty of her felony charge she will face two to ten years in prison.
